Financial Forensics: Utilizing accounting and investigative techniques to uncover hidden wealth and financial irregularities.
In the context of "The Hidden Wealth: Decoding Fotis Dulos' Net Worth," financial forensics plays a crucial role in uncovering hidden wealth and exposing financial irregularities. Financial forensic experts employ specialized accounting and investigative techniques to meticulously examine financial data and transactions, often in complex and high-stakes cases.
- Forensic Accounting: Forensic accountants analyze financial records, including bank statements, tax returns, and business documents, to identify anomalies, inconsistencies, and evidence of fraud or financial misconduct. Their expertise helps trace the flow of funds, uncover hidden assets, and reconstruct complex financial transactions.
- Data Analytics: Financial forensic investigators leverage data analytics techniques to sift through large volumes of financial data, identifying patterns and anomalies that may indicate hidden wealth or illicit activities. Advanced data analysis tools can detect suspicious transactions, entities, and uncover hidden connections.
- Transaction Tracing: By meticulously following the movement of funds through various accounts and transactions, financial forensic experts can map out the flow of hidden wealth and identify the individuals or entities involved in illicit activities. This process helps uncover complex financial schemes and track the proceeds of crime.
- Asset Tracing: Financial forensics involves tracing and identifying hidden assets, such as real estate, luxury goods, or offshore accounts, that may be used to conceal wealth or launder illicit funds. Asset tracing requires a deep understanding of financial markets, legal structures, and international jurisdictions.

Legal Loopholes: Examining how individuals exploit legal loopholes and complex financial structures to conceal wealth.
In the context of "The Hidden Wealth: Decoding Fotis Dulos' Net Worth," understanding legal loopholes and complex financial structures is crucial as they provide avenues for individuals to conceal their wealth and evade legal scrutiny.
Legal loopholes refer to gaps or ambiguities in laws that allow individuals to exploit the system for their own benefit. Complex financial structures, such as trusts, offshore companies, and shell corporations, can be employed to further obfuscate the ownership and movement of assets.
For instance, individuals may create offshore trusts in jurisdictions with lax regulations to avoid taxes and hide assets from creditors or law enforcement. Shell companies, with no real business operations, can be used to purchase assets and hold them anonymously.
The use of legal loopholes and complex financial structures poses significant challenges for law enforcement and asset recovery specialists seeking to uncover hidden wealth. It requires a deep understanding of financial markets, legal frameworks, and international jurisdictions to effectively pierce through these layers of concealment.

Legal Consequences: Discussing the potential legal ramifications for individuals involved in hiding assets and engaging in financial misconduct.
In the context of "The Hidden Wealth: Decoding Fotis Dulos' Net Worth," understanding the legal consequences is crucial, as it examines the potential criminal and civil penalties faced by individuals who engage in financial misconduct and attempt to conceal their assets.
- Tax Evasion and Fraud: Hiding assets and income to avoid paying taxes is a serious crime that can result in substantial fines, imprisonment, and asset forfeiture.
- Money Laundering: Attempting to conceal the source of illegally obtained funds through financial transactions can lead to charges of money laundering, with severe penalties including fines and prison time.
- Bankruptcy Fraud: Hiding assets during bankruptcy proceedings is a federal crime that can result in additional charges and penalties, extending the legal consequences beyond the initial bankruptcy filing.
- Obstruction of Justice: Intentionally concealing assets or providing false information during legal proceedings or investigations can constitute obstruction of justice, a serious offense with potential criminal penalties.
